The Odoo App Store is your premier destination for robust business solutions. Whether you're needing to automate your workflows or implement innovative features, the App Store offers a extensive range of apps to suit https://odooappstore.com/
Unleash Your Business Potential with the Odoo App Store
Internet - 2 hours 56 minutes ago cyrusmnqx234139Web Directory Categories
Web Directory Search
New Site Listings